Prevents condensation
Condensation is a phenomenon that occurs on windows as air cools and forms moisture. This is a natural process that is common in all areas of your home. It’s also more frequent in the spring and summer, when humidity levels are higher. While it can be irritating but it’s not always negative and could even improve the efficiency of your home.
Condensation that occurs in double-glazed windows is an indication that the seal on the insulated glass unit (IGU) has failed. The issue can be resolved without having to replace the entire window. A technician will make tiny holes on the top of the window and on the bottom to allow the moisture be able to escape. This will clear the fog from the windows as well as any magnesium or calcium deposits.
A specialist will apply an anti-fog coating on the window after the moisture has been eliminated. The coating will stop future condensation of water on windows. To prevent condensation, it is important to ensure that your kitchen and bathroom have enough ventilation.
Over time the seals on insulated windows may fail due to various reasons. Insufficient ventilation, repeated sunlight exposure, and seasonal weather changes can all cause seals to fail. Seals on the southern and western sides of a house are more susceptible to fail. However, you can avoid damaged window seals by observing simple maintenance tips. It is best not to apply reflective window films to your insulated glass since they could damage the seals.

Prevents noise
Noise pollution can have a negative effect on your health and well-being. It can affect your sleep pattern and cause a range of health issues. The good part is that you can reduce the amount of noise outside your home by installing double glazing. This will prevent you from being disturbed by the sounds of traffic, planes, or even your noisy neighbour’s leaf-blower.
While a single piece of glass can be a powerful block against noise, double or triple glazing can dramatically improve the performance of your windows by making them much quieter. The air gap between the two panes of the window is an important factor in its performance. The thickness of the panes as well as the size of the air gap will also influence its acoustic properties. The larger the gap the better it will perform at blocking sound.
A coating on the inside of the glass can enhance the acoustic properties of your double-glazed. If you’re looking to increase the acoustic performance of your windows, then you can opt for an STC (Sound Transmission Class) upgrade. This involves combining a number of glass panes that have different thicknesses. As sound waves travel between the panes they are distorted and the reduction in sound produced makes your windows more acoustic. This is particularly useful for homes located close to railway tracks or busy roads.
